Introduction to Sheep Slaughtering Equipment

The realm of meat processing is intricate and demands specialized sheep slaughtering equipment to ensure efficiency and compliance with hygiene standards. This category encompasses a variety of machines designed to facilitate the humane and sanitary processing of sheep from farm to table.

Types and Applications

Within this sector, there exists a diverse array of equipment tailored to different scales of operation. From compact units ideal for small-scale butchers to industrial-grade machinery capable of handling high-volume processing, the selection is vast. The applications of this equipment are equally varied, supporting activities such as stunning, bleeding, dehiding, and evisceration.

Features and Materials

Modern sheep processing equipment is engineered with features that prioritize animal welfare, operator safety, and food hygiene. Materials like stainless steel are commonly used for their durability and ease of cleaning, which is crucial in preventing cross-contamination and ensuring the longevity of the machinery.

Advantages of Updated Equipment

Investing in the latest meat processing technology can yield significant advantages. Enhanced efficiency, improved yield, and adherence to animal welfare standards are just a few of the benefits. Moreover, equipment with advanced features can contribute to a smoother workflow, reducing the physical strain on workers and potentially increasing throughput.

Considerations for Selection

When selecting commercial sheep slaughtering equipment, several factors should be considered. The capacity of the machine is paramount for businesses aiming to scale operations. Additionally, the ease of maintenance and availability of spare parts are critical for minimizing downtime. Prospective buyers should also consider the equipment's compatibility with their existing processing line to ensure a seamless integration.

Maintenance and Hygiene

Maintenance is a non-negotiable aspect of meat processing, and slaughterhouse equipment is no exception. Choosing machines that are easy to disassemble and clean can save time and enhance food safety. Hygiene is paramount, and equipment that is designed with this in mind helps maintain the highest standards of meat quality.
